Flaky suite: LedgerFox payment-retry tests. Root cause was the mock gateway reusing idempotency keys across parallel shards, so retries returned stale responses. Fix: keys now derive from shard ID plus attempt counter. If the suite fails again, check the key-collision log first, not the network mocks. Rerun with the retry harness pinned to the exact build; the reference token for that pinned image is recorded immediately below.

session token of tajef-bageg = htk21_5d90d574934f3ccae6437

**Runbook: CSV Import Wizard stalls at validation**

When the Coppervane import wizard hangs on step two, check the validation worker queue for orphaned jobs older than ten minutes and requeue them. Confirm delimiter detection settings match the uploaded file before retrying. When escalating, always include the build identifier shown below.

trace token, fafog-kageg: htk4_98e6

# Break-Glass: Catalog Cache Invalidation

Scope: the Pinrow product catalog at Veldstone Retail. If stale prices persist after a purge and the Hollowmere invalidation queue is wedged, use break-glass to flush the edge tier directly. Contractors: get verbal sign-off from the catalog lead first. Steps: open the Hollowmere admin shell, select emergency-flush, confirm the tenant, and run it once — repeated flushes thrash the origin. Access is logged and expires after 20 minutes. Unseal the admin shell with the passphrase below.

recovery phrase for kahop-tajog: istix-casvan